Job Duties & Responsibilities
Purpose of the Role

Responsible for entering the Bill of Materials into the ERP system and creating special BOMs and routings for custom jobs. Part numbers shall be created and maintained based upon engineering bill of materials. Ensure the smooth transition for all engineering changes and communicate effectively to minimize operational issues. This role is responsible for ensuring custom orders are built to the specs given by the customer and directing the floor as to what materials to use to build the order. This position must communicate with the assembly team to ensure product is built correctly.

What You Will Be Doing
  • Building structures for custom orders.
  • Work with Purchasing to buy special materials and track materials to ensure timely delivery for major projects.
  • Entering BOMs for new products and changing BOMs when required from an ECR or ECO.
  • Work with Product Development to set up custom order process on new products.
  • Work closely with scheduling team and production leads.
  • Modify product drawings in SolidWorks.
  • Assist in ECR execution.
  • Audit system structures and item cards.
  • Work on Kaizen Teams to support engineering modifications and specials processes.
  • Work with the Manufacturing Engineering team on active projects.
  • Engage in monitoring and enhancing processes and internal controls.
  • Drive improvements on custom orders process to ensure satisfaction with both internal and external customers.
